The binding of SARS-CoV-2 nucleocapsid (N) protein to both the 5'- and 3'-ends of genomic RNA has different implications arising from its binding to the central region during virion assembly. However, the mechanism underlying selective binding remains unknown. Herein, we performed the high-throughput RNA-SELEX (HTR-SELEX) to determine the RNA-binding specificity of the N proteins of various SARS-CoV-2 variants as well as other {beta}-coronaviruses and showed that N proteins could bind two unrelated sequences, both of which were highly conserved across all variants and species. Interestingly, both these sequence motifs are virtually absent from the human transcriptome; however, they exhibit a highly enriched, mutually complementary distribution in the coronavirus genome, highlighting their varied functions in genome packaging. Our results provide mechanistic insights into viral genome packaging, thereby increasing the feasibility of developing drugs with broad-spectrum anti-coronavirus activity by targeting RNA binding by N proteins.

Neuroinflammation is an important part of the development of neurodegenerative diseases such as Alzheimer's disease (AD), Parkinson's and amyotrophic lateral sclerosis. Inflammatory factors destroy the balance of the microenvironment, which results in changes in neural stem cell differentiation and proliferation behaviour. However, the mechanism underlying inflammatory factor-induced NSC behavioural changes is not clear. Resistin is a proinflammatory and adipogenic factor and is involved in several human pathology processes. The neural stem cell microenvironment changes when the concentration of resistin in the brain during an inflammatory response disease increases. In the present study, we explored the effect and mechanism of resistin on the proliferation and differentiation of neural stem cells. We found that intracerebroventricular injection of resistin induced a decrease in GFAP-positive cells in mice by influencing NSC differentiation. Resistin significantly decreased TEER and increased permeability in an in vitro blood-brain barrier model, which is consistent with the results of an HBMEC-astrocyte coculture system. Resistin-inhibited astrocyte differentiation is mediated through TLR4 on neural stem cells. To our knowledge, this is the first study reporting the effect of resistin on neural stem cells. Our findings shed light on resistin-involved neural stem cell degeneration mechanisms.

Objective:To study the expression level of peripheral blood mircoRNA-155 and the variation characteristics of CD4+T cell percentage and to expound the clinical significance of mircoRNA-155 quantitative test and CD 4+T cell percentage cytological test.Methods:Fluorescent quantitative PCR had been used to detect the expression level of mircoRNA -155 in the peripheral blood.Flow cytometry had been used to detect the cell percentage of the peripheral blood T lymphocyte subset CD 3+T cell,CD4+T cell and CD8+T cell.The mircoRNA-155 expression levels and the cell percentages of CD 4+T were tested respectively in the selected 40 patients with atopic dermatitis ,30 patients with skin eczema and 30 healthy controls.Finally,the differences of the above groups were counted and analyzed .Results:The relative expression levels of mircoRNA-155 of the atopic dermatitis group were higher than those of the eczema group and the normal control group ( P<0.05 ).The CD4+T cell percentage of the atopic dermatitis group was higher than those of the eczema group and the normal control group ( P<0.05 ) .Conclusion: The expression level of the peripheral blood mircoRNA-155 in the patients with atopic dermatitis is increased significantly and CD 4+T cell percentage in the patients is raised as well.Consequently ,the clinical detection of miRNA-155 and CD4+T cell shall be of great significance .

Objective:To investigate the correlation between single nucleotide polymorphism ( SNP ) of rs7517847 and rs10489629 on IL-23R gene and susceptibility of ankylosing spondylitis in Jilin.Methods:IL-23R gene polymorphisms of 188 cases on ankylosing spondylitis were detected by polymerase chain reaction-restriction fragment length polymorphism ( PCR-RFLP ) , compared with those of 100 cases of healthy control group.Results:The frequency distribution differences ,between AS group and comparison group of separate genotype and the allele on two SNPs (rs7517847 and rs10489629) both showed statistical significance (P<0.05).Meanwhile, by the assumed genetic way , compared homozygous mutant GG of rs 7517847 with TG+TT, compared homozygous mutant AA of rs10489629 with GA+GG,such frequency distribution difference between the above two groups also showed statistical significance ( P<0.05).Conclusion:Polymorphisms about IL-23R gene of the rs7517847 and rs10489629 are both associated with susceptibility of AS in Jilin.The risk of AS will be increased if the person both with G/A allele and GG/AA genotype , which may be one of susceptive factors by AS.

<p><b>OBJECTIVE</b>To establish a convenient and accurate method of DNA molecular marker for the identification of corium stomachium galli.</p><p><b>METHOD</b>Cytb mtDNA sequences of Gallus gallus domestica and three other species of poultry were downloaded from Genbank. Species-specific PCR primers were designed according to the differential DNA fragments of the cytb genes. PCR tests were performed with the DNAs extracted from G. gallus domestica, three other poultry species and domestic mammal animals.</p><p><b>RESULT</b>The specific primers of G. gallus domestica could only amplify the cytb mtDNA of G. gallus domestica.</p><p><b>CONCLUSION</b>The primers are specific to G. gallus domestica mtDNA and can used to discern Corium stomachium from the false medicine.</p>

Objective To analyze the trend of cervical cancer, age structure and influencing factors. Methods Retrospective study and survey. The 1563 patients with cervical cancer and gynecological medical examination of 600 non-cervical cancer patients who took part in Physical examination in the obstetrics and gynecology department received the enclosed analysis questionnaire. Results Cervical cancer is becoming a trend of cervical cancer patients being younger, high risk period at the age of 36 to 55, and the downward trend towards the menopausal women. The number of being pregnant, ma]-sexuality (the first sexual intercourse at a younger age, or many sexual partners), and smoking are the causes which lead to cervical cancer. Conclusion Give great importance to a trend of cervical cancer patients being younger; screening, publicity and education about cervical cancer;, missionaries and strengthen anti-cancer awareness, promote a healthy lifestyle, which is the key to prevention and treatment of cervical cancer.

Objective To establish a method for quantitative determination of triptolide and triptonide in human plasma samples by HPLC.Methods The samples were extracted with Oasis HLB solid phase extraction cartridge and analyzed with reserved phase HPLC coupled with diode array detection.Results Recoveries rates obtained from spiked plasma for the two diterpenoid were higher than 80%.The linearity ranged from 10 ng/ml to 1 000 ng/ml.Detection limits of the method were 3.0ng/ml for triptolide and 4.5ng/ml for triptonide.Conclusion The method is fast and accurate,which is applicable to determination of diterpenoid in cases of suspected poisoning of Triptergium wilfordii Hook.f. in forensic practice.
